| SENATE RESOLUTION
| 2 |
| W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ois Senate wish to express | 3 |
| their sincere condolences to the family and friends of Sergeant | 4 |
| Jason C. Denfrund, who died on Christmas Day, 2006, defending | 5 |
| our country in Operation Iraqi Freedom; and
| 6 |
| WHEREAS, Sergeant Denfrund was assigned to the 10th | 7 |
| Mountain Division (Light Infantry) in Fort Drum, New York; he | 8 |
| was assigned to Company B, 2nd Battalion, "Golden Dragons", | 9 |
| 14th Infantry Regiment in Iraq; and
| 10 |
| WHEREAS, Jason Denfrund grew up in Cattaraugus, New York, | 11 |
| where he played football and was Captain of the Cattaraugus | 12 |
| Central High School football team in 1999; he also attended | 13 |
| SUNY Brockport, where he also played football; and
| 14 |
| WHEREAS, Jason Denfrund enlisted in the United States Army | 15 |
| in June of 2001; he completed basic and advanced training at | 16 |
| Fort Benning, Georgia; his first duty assignment was in the 2nd | 17 |
| Battalion, 2nd Infantry Brigade at Rose Barracks in Vilseck, | 18 |
| Germany; in December of 2003 he was reassigned to Fort Drum; | 19 |
| and
| 20 |
| WHEREAS, Sergeant Denfrund was previously deployed to the | 21 |
| Balkans and was on his third tour of duty to Iraq; he received |

| the Purple Heart, the Army Commendation Medal, the Army | 2 |
| Achievement Medal, the Army Good Conduct Medal, the National | 3 |
| Defense Service Medal, the Kosovo Campaign Medal, the Iraq | 4 |
| Campaign Medal, the Global War on Terrorism Service Medal, the | 5 |
| Army Service Ribbon, the NATO Medal, the Combat Infantryman | 6 |
| Badge, the Expert Infantry Badge, and the Driver Badge; and
| 7 |
| WHEREAS, Sergeant Jason C. Denfrund is survived by his | 8 |
| wife, Melissa (Sanzone); his daughter, Chloe; and his son, | 9 |
| Jayden; therefore, be it
| 10 |
| RESOLVED, BY THE SENATE OF THE NINETY-FIFTH GENERAL | 11 |
| ASSEMBLY OF THE STATE OF ILLINOIS, that we mourn this brave | 12 |
| soldier, proud father, and loving husband and extend to the | 13 |
| family and friends of Sergeant Jason C. Denfrund our sincere | 14 |
| sympathies at this time; and be it further
| 15 |
| RESOLVED, That we honor the memory of Sergeant Jason C. | 16 |
| Denfrund and his willingness to serve his country, which led to | 17 |
| him making the ultimate sacrifice; and be it further | 18 |
| RESOLVED, That a suitable copy of this resolution be | 19 |
| presented to the family of Sergeant Jason C. Denfrund as a | 20 |
| symbol of our respect for his dedication to our country.
